He’s light but lengthwise I think he’s a small wing. 6’8.5” wingspan at 6’5” in shoes. Not great length albeit but that’s how the guy went undrafted In the first place.Is Ellis a wing? Dude clocked in at around 167 at the combine.
I guess now would be a good time to mention that Mike Brown gets credited for helping turn Bruce Bowen into the best 3-and-D player of his time despite being allergic to dribbling.He needs to add size, but I absolutely see some Danny Green in his game. Very versatile and hounding perimeter defender and the C&S 3-ball and the 1 dribble fake and pull looks super polished. The handle looks....broken, but I think a good coach can utilize his classic "3andD" skill-set and make him a useful player.
Spend the year in Stockton bulking up and potentially could see him step into the Justin Holiday role in 2023. Overall a good upside swing with some valuable skills.
